Solar Power Advancements
Spain enjoys some of the highest levels of solar irradiance in Europe, making it an ideal location for solar power generation. Spanish companies and research institutions have been at the forefront of developing advanced solar technologies, including concentrated solar power (CSP) and photovoltaic (PV) systems. CSP plants, like the Gemasolar plant in Seville, use mirrors to focus sunlight and generate heat, which is then used to produce electricity. These plants often incorporate thermal storage systems, allowing them to generate electricity even when the sun isn't shining. Furthermore, Spanish researchers are constantly working on improving the efficiency and reducing the cost of PV panels, making solar energy an increasingly competitive and accessible source of power.
Wind Energy Innovations
Wind energy is another area where Spain excels. The country has a well-developed wind energy sector, with numerous wind farms located across its windy regions. Spanish engineers have been instrumental in designing and manufacturing wind turbines that are more efficient, reliable, and environmentally friendly. Innovations in wind turbine technology include the development of larger turbines with longer blades, which can capture more wind energy. Additionally, Spanish companies are exploring offshore wind energy, which has the potential to provide a significant amount of clean electricity. The integration of wind energy into the national grid has also been a focus, with advanced grid management systems ensuring a stable and reliable power supply.
